/** * Graphics::PNG is PNG library * * text.c includes one class: * Graphics::PNG::Text. * This class is wrapper object for libpng's png_text_struct struct. * It's for the representation of text chunks. * * @author DATE Ken (as Itacchi) / ge6537@i.bekkoame.ne.jp * @code-name Aoi * @see http://www.isc.meiji.ac.jp/~ee77038/ruby/ * $Id: text.c,v 1.1 2000/09/27 17:17:03 date Exp date $ */ #include "libpng.h" VALUE cText; /* * ------------------- * Graphics::PNG::Text * ------------------- * is a wrapper object of the libpng's png_text_struct struct. */ /* =begin = (({Graphics::PNG::Text})) A wrapper object of the libpng's png_text_struct struct. === class method --- Graphics::PNG::Text.new Create PNG text data for text chunk object. === Constant : ((<(({Graphics::PNG::TEXT_COMPRESSION_NONE_WR}))>)) : ((<(({Graphics::PNG::TEXT_COMPRESSION_zTXt_WR}))>)) : ((<(({Graphics::PNG::TEXT_COMPRESSION_NONE}))>)) : ((<(({Graphics::PNG::TEXT_COMPRESSION_zTXt}))>)) : ((<(({Graphics::PNG::ITXT_COMPRESSION_NONE}))>)) : ((<(({Graphics::PNG::ITXT_COMPRESSION_zTXt}))>)) === instance method --- Graphics::PNG::Text#compression Get compression type. Default is Graphics::PNG::TEXT_COMPRESSION_NONE. * ((<(({Graphics::PNG::TEXT_COMPRESSION_NONE_WR}))>)) -3, tEXt, none, wide character * ((<(({Graphics::PNG::TEXT_COMPRESSION_zTXt_WR}))>)) -2, zTXt, deflate, wide character * ((<(({Graphics::PNG::TEXT_COMPRESSION_NONE}))>)) -1, tEXt, none * ((<(({Graphics::PNG::TEXT_COMPRESSION_zTXt}))>)) 0, zTXt, deflate, * ((<(({Graphics::PNG::ITXT_COMPRESSION_NONE}))>)) 1, iTXt, none * ((<(({Graphics::PNG::ITXT_COMPRESSION_zTXt}))>)) 2, iTXt, deflate --- Graphics::PNG::Text#compression=(val) Set compression type. --- Graphics::PNG::Text#key Get keyword (description of "text"). 1-79 character. --- Graphics::PNG::Text#key=(string) Set keyword, 1-79 Latin-1 character. But, don't check character code. This is task for users. --- Graphics::PNG::Text#lang Get language code. --- Graphics::PNG::Text#lang=(str) Set language code, 1-79 characters. `nil' for unknown. But, don't check character code. This is task for users. --- Graphics::PNG::Text#lang_key Get keyword translated UTF-8 string. --- Graphics::PNG::Text#lang_key=(str) Set keyword translated UTF-8 string. But, don't check character code. This is task for users. --- Graphics::PNG::Text#text Get comment. --- Graphics::PNG::Text#text=(str) Set comment. Empty string is also valid. =end */ #ifdef PNG_TEXT_SUPPORTED /* * --------------------- * utility function for * Graphics::PNG::Text * --------------------- */ void libpng_text_check_type(obj) VALUE obj;
